About Astrological Chart Reading Throughout History Astrology has a rich multicultural history. Mankind is reputed to have been consulting the stars since
the beginning of time. Recorded formal use of the stars as being relevant to how humans lived their lives is attributed to have originated in Mesopotamia in the 3rd millennium B.C. It spread to India. It developed its Western form in Greek civilization during the Hellenistic period and entered Islamic culture as part of the Greek tradition and was returned to European culture through Arabic learning during the Middle Ages. Clearly Astrology is a discipline with a rich and broad depth of meaning.
Telescope observations that commenced in the early seventeenth century opened up new heavenly realms and thus significantly impacted changes in both astronomy and astrology.
